'Slack' <https://slack.com/> provides a service for teams to collaborate by sharing messages, images, links, files and more. Functions are provided that make it possible to interact with the 'Slack' platform 'API'. When you need to share information or data from R, rather than resort to copy/ paste in e-mails or other services like 'Skype' <https://www.skype.com/en/>, you can use this package to send well-formatted output from multiple R objects and expressions to all teammates at the same time with little effort. You can also send images from the current graphics device, R objects, and upload files.
